Transaction 51cdd39d3745af76724789bb5c70ff3db41e4bffb40826f0c6be64df52591b09
4 Input
2 Outputs
- 51cdd39d3745af76724789bb5c70ff3db41e4bffb40826f0c6be64df52591b09:0
- 51cdd39d3745af76724789bb5c70ff3db41e4bffb40826f0c6be64df52591b09:1
value 31017
address 1K8WFQVjEPZgm8vjbwSGWfgybrGFZVHrmQ
value 4000000
address 31i2W56BbJyQYQn6A9pD1Amyq4pwfjuXAw